How to Perform a Heavy Groin Kick
-
Stance & Positioning: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, knees slightly bent, and hands up in a guard position.
-
Targeting: Aim for the groin area, but visualize kicking through the target rather than stopping at impact.
-
Knee Drive: Lift your knee sharply upward toward the target.
-
Strike Execution: Extend your lower leg rapidly, using your shin rather than your foot to strike. This prevents injury to the small bones in your foot.
-
Hip Engagement: Drive your hips forward and upward to maximize power.
-
Follow-Through & Recovery: After impact, immediately return to your guard position and prepare for follow-up movements.
This technique is highly effective because the groin is a sensitive area with nerve pathways that trigger intense pain and temporary incapacitation
